TOEFL known as Test of English as a Foreign Language measures the ability of individuals whose native language is not English and to make them speak, write and understand English that would be used in institutions of higher learning. Typically, applicants take the TOEFL sometime after their junior year of high school before applying to colleges or universities or graduate programs where English is the principal language. The TOEFL results are accepted at over 6000 universities and licensing agencies in 110 countries and the test can be taken worldwide. TOEFL is primarily administered as an internet-based test (iBT) given at Thompson Prometric Centers, although a paper-based test is still being utilized at some other sites. The entire test is taken in one day, which saves you travel time and costs. And, there are more than 4,000 test centers to choose from.
